What is the NYCSEF Student Project Registration Form?

The NYCSEF Student Project Registration Form is a critical document used by students participating in the New York City Science and Engineering Fair. Its primary purpose is to provide essential details about the student team, project title, adult sponsor, and other relevant information. This registration form ensures that students are properly enrolled and prepared for the fair, reflecting the importance of organizing their ideas effectively.
Information required includes team details, project specifications, and documentation such as research plans and abstracts. By accurately filling out the NYCSEF project registration form, students can streamline their entry into this prestigious event.

How to Fill Out the NYCSEF Student Project Registration Form Online (Step-by-Step)

Filling out the NYCSEF Student Project Registration Form online involves several steps to ensure accuracy and completeness. Follow these directions:
  • Access the NYCSEF registration form on the official website.
  • Enter student and team details, including names and contact information.
  • Provide the project title and a brief description of your research.
  • Attach necessary documents such as research plans and abstracts.
  • Review all entries for accuracy before submission.
Gather necessary documents beforehand to expedite the process and ensure that all required fields are complete.
